The story of one dog's attempt to save his family, become a star, and eat a lot of bacon.

Cosmo's family is falling apart.

And it's up to Cosmo to keep them together.

He knows exactly what to do.

There's only one problem.

Cosmo is a Golden Retriever.

Wise, funny, and filled with warmth and heart, this is Charlotte's Web meets Little Miss Sunshine: a moving, beautiful story, with a wonderfully unique hero, from an incredible new voice in middle grade fiction - perfect for fans of Rebecca Stead and Kate DiCamillo.

'This gem has all the warmth and joy of Homeward Bound, and is making me want to get a golden retriever immediately.' - Catherine Doyle, author of The Storm Keeper's Island'Cosmo's narration combines wit, heart, stubbornness, and a grouchy dignity, all ably tugging at funny bones and heartstrings alike.' - Kirkus (starred review)'I adored this, a genuine feel-good delight with the most lovable animal narrator I've read in ages.' - Fiona Noble, The Bookseller'Like any good dog, Cosmo is so funny, friendly, and loyal that he quickly became a dear friend, so much so that when I finished reading the book, I missed hearing his voice and picturing his shaggy face. Come back, Cosmo!' - Jim Gorant, author of the New York Times bestseller The Lost Dogs
